Description:

"Dhirubhai-1" is an FPSO, which serves as a versatile and mobile floating vessel designed for offshore oil and gas production, storage, and offloading. It is named after the Indian business tycoon Dhirubhai Ambani.

Primary Functions:

  • Extraction and processing of hydrocarbons from offshore wells.
  • Separating oil, gas, and water from the production stream.
  • Storing processed oil until it can be offloaded onto shuttle tankers or pipelines.
  • Possibly providing utilities such as power, water, and gas compression for the production facility.
